Yuanqi Zai (元气仔) is smartphone maker Honor's first humanoid robot, debuted on stage at MWC 2026 in Barcelona (March 1) alongside its Robot Phone — a matte-black service humanoid with a head-mounted camera and a glowing chest strip, demonstrated walking, dancing, posing and interacting with Honor's CEO on stage. Honor positions it for shopping assistance, workplace inspections and companionship, part of the company's broader push beyond smartphones into physical/embodied AI under its 'Augmented Human Intelligence' strategy, backed by a reported $10 billion AI investment. It represents the wave of Chinese consumer-electronics giants (alongside Xiaomi's CyberOne and Xpeng) entering humanoid robotics. NOTE: Honor deliberately disclosed NO formal specifications, pricing or commercial timeline at the reveal — height, weight, DOF, payload, battery and actuators are all UNpublished and flagged for outreach, NOT invented. This is a development-stage reveal; only confirmed design features and stated purpose are recorded.
